Superbowl 2010: Recent Betting Trends

By: CTS Guest Capper     Date: Feb 7, 2010
Print Article   

Hard to believe but yes its once again time for the biggest game of the year. The 2010 Super Bowl faces two of the most exciting teams including some of the biggest stars in the NFL. Both of these teams were the number one seeds coming into the playoffs and the homefield advantage got them to this point. Oddsmakers have been busy already sitting and moving the line on the game, currently the Colts are -5.5 point favorite and the total is at 56.5. But the betting oppurtunites do not end their as the wagers seem almost endless with a million different props as well.

Recent Super Bowl Betting Trends

  • AFC domination straight up as they have won 5 of last 6 games including last years winner Pittsburgh.
  • Favorites have not done well Against the Spread in Recent Super Bowl going 2-4 ATS
  • Money Line Favorites have been money in recent years going 5-1 straight up
  • Super Bowl Totals have been under the listed total in 4 of the last 6 Super Bowls but was over in last years game.
